  • Patent number: 5534229
    Abstract: A volatilization suppressing agent comprising at least one thermosensitive polymer as an effective component is disclosed. Also disclosed is a volatile composition comprising a volatile effective component or an effective component carried by a volatile solvent and at least one thermosensitive polymer are disclosed. The use of the volatilization suppressing agent can suppress volatilization of volatile components when temperature rises and, as a result, volatilization of the volatile components is less affected by the temperature change. It is therefore possible to volatilize volatile components from air fresheners, deodorants, insecticides, moth proofers, repellents, attractants, antimicrobial agents, antifungal agents, antioxidants, and ozone decomposition agents more economically and to prevent troubles due to excessive volatilization.

  • Patent number: 4929404
    Abstract: A graphitic or carbonaceous molding comprising graphite powder and a mesophase-containing pitch is obtained by suspending graphite powder in a tar, heating the suspension while blowing an inert gas therein to form the mesophase-containing pitch on the graphite particles to obtain carbonaceous precursors and molding/carbonizing or graphitizing the carbonaceous precursors.

  • Patent number: 4596652
    Abstract: A process for producing a mesophase pitch by heating a carbonaceous pitch at 350.degree. to 550.degree. C. wherein the heat treatment is conducted while supplying a hydrogen donor to the pitch. The mesophase pitch thus produced has an excellent spinnability.

  • Patent number: 4300002
    Abstract: A polycyclic diol is produced by a hydroformylation of a polycyclic bridged ring olefinic compound having another double bond, formyl or methylol group, in the presence of a cobalt compound and a phosphine as a catalyst in the presence of a saturated hydrocarbon or aromatic hydrocarbon.Polycyclic diols such as tricyclodecanedimethylol are useful for hardeners for non-solvent type lacquers polyurethanes having heat resistant and chemical resistance or epoxy resins.
